Company Overview - Hengtong Optic-Electric Co., Ltd. is located in Suzhou, Jiangsu Province, China, and was established on June 5, 1993. The company was listed on August 22, 2003. Its main business involves high-end technology, product research and development, and system integration services in the fields of communication networks and energy interconnection, as well as the construction of global submarine cable communication networks [1]. Financial Performance - For the period from January to September 2025, Hengtong Optic-Electric achieved operating revenue of 49.621 billion yuan, representing a year-on-year growth of 17.03%. The net profit attributable to the parent company was 2.376 billion yuan, an increase of 2.64% year-on-year [2]. - The company has cumulatively distributed 2.614 billion yuan in dividends since its A-share listing, with 1.121 billion yuan distributed over the past three years [3]. Shareholder Structure - As of September 30, 2025, the number of shareholders of Hengtong Optic-Electric was 191,800, an increase of 18.60% from the previous period. The average number of circulating shares per person was 12,747, a decrease of 15.68% [2]. - Among the top ten circulating shareholders, Hong Kong Central Clearing Limited held 78.7403 million shares, an increase of 14.2357 million shares compared to the previous period. The Southern CSI 500 ETF held 28.7342 million shares, a decrease of 600,500 shares [3].
